    I think the smaller ones would be nice, but boesmani rainbows get too big. That's why he sold the angels. They defeat the sense of scale in the tank when they get too big.

    I recon some hatchets would be pretty cool in there.

    Then tetras, small rasboras... Dwarf cichlids too.
